VisualBasic の FtpWebRequest って、FTP プロキシ使えないんでやんの

いやぁ、まいっちんぐ・・・とか、ふざけてる場合じゃないけどなあ。(^^;

Visual Basic 2010 使ってファイルを FTP PUT するプログラムを書いてたんだが、もう納品って時になって、「VB.NET の FtpWebRequest じゃ、FTP プロキシ越しの FTP PUT は出来ない」ってことが判明。(FtpWebRequest クラスがサポートしてるのは、HTTP プロキシおよび ISA ファイアウォールクライアントプロキシのみだと)

お客さんとこの環境は、FTP プロキシ経由でないと外に出れん。むーん。

しかも、(商用しか調べてないが)VB.NET 2010 に対応した FTP 機能強化するコンポーネントも売ってない。2010 の C# だと FtpWebRequest クラスで FTP プロキシ使えるそうなので、2010 対応は商売にならんという判断か???)

まあ、VB.NET でも、自分でソケット通信部分を書けば FTP プロキシ経由の通信も可能だと思うが、さすがに時間がないのでなあ。

ちゅうことで、現在、FTP 通信のところだけ、Active Perl で作りましょうと・・・と提案中。Perl なら、NET::FTP モジュール使って FTP プロキシ経由の通信も出来そう。

しかし、FTP プロキシに対応してないとは、Visual Basic の FtpWebRequest クラス、中途半端すぎ(^^; 使えねぇ~

<追記>
つ~とこで、大ごとになってきたので、今週末の少年野球がらみのあれこれは嫁さんに任せた。なので、申し訳ないが審判も他の人にお願いするしかないわなあ。

トラックバック(0)

このブログ記事を参照しているブログ一覧: VisualBasic の FtpWebRequest って、FTP プロキシ使えないんでやんの

このブログ記事に対するトラックバックURL: https://blog.netandfield.com/mt/mt-tb.cgi/1502

コメントする

このブログ記事について

このページは、shinodaが2011年3月 8日 15:47に書いたブログ記事です。

ひとつ前のブログ記事は「VB.NET でも UNIX のエポックタイムが使いたい」です。

次のブログ記事は「毎朝、立派な霜柱が一面に・・・」です。

最近のコンテンツはインデックスページで見られます。過去に書かれたものはアーカイブのページで見られます。


月別 アーカイブ

電気ウナギ的○○ mobile ver.

携帯版「電気ウナギ的○○」はこちら